Let’s start with skincare, shall we? First up is a body cream in a new scent from Bath and Body Works called ‘Calm’. This lotion has key notes of Cedarwood and Orange. I’m usually not one for citrusy scents but the cedarwood balances it out nicely. I love the Bath and Body Works body creams, they’re thicker than the usual lotion making them great to use at bedtime. I actually have two body cream loves this month, the other is the famous Sol de Janeiro Brazilian Bum Bum Cream. I received this in one of my Allure Beauty Boxes and at first, I was unsure as to if I was going to like it. When I finally did try it I was pleasantly surprised. It’s tropical but not nauseatingly so. The scent isn’t overpowering and it’s thick but not super thick so that I can only use it in the evening. The last skincare piece I’ve been loving was sent to me through Influenster for review and it is the Olay Eyes Retinol 24 eye cream. This eye cream is highly moisturizing and creamy. With this product, a little goes a very long way. It has helped especially with the outer corners of my eyes which tend to be a little more discolored than my undereye and eyelid area. I’m so glad I got to try this product because it has really made a difference in my nighttime skincare routine.

Up next we have some makeup products, starting with the base and ending with finishing sprays. First up is the foundation I have fallen head over heels with, the Tarte Amazonian Clay Full Coverage Foundation in ‘Fair Sand’. I got this during the last spring VIB Rouge sale at Sephora but it wasn’t until recently that I started using it on the regular. When it says full coverage it truly means it. One pass with the sponge is a medium/full coverage and a second pass is full coverage through and through. What I really like is that, on me at least, it doesn’t look cakey even after I have applied concealer and powder. The other foundation I’ve been really like is the Colourpop No Filter Foundation in ‘Fair 30’. This foundation has really good coverage but also allows your own skin show through which I really like. It’s not heavy at all, sometimes I’ve been known to forget I have foundation on when wearing this- it’s that good! I like the pump bottle, I find two to three pumps to be the perfect amount for a full face with going back over problem spots. Now for the setting sprays. Well, this first one isn’t a setting spray per se but I use it before I use setting spray to help melt the makeup into my skin. I’m talking about the Glow Mist by Pixi. When I first received this I wasn’t too sure about it because of the oil mixed in but I have really come to love it. The oil doesn’t make my skin look oily or anything but it doesn’t make it feel hydrated and gives a bit of extra glow when you apply it then pat it in. This is the first Pixi product I’ve ever actually liked and I’m pretty sure that when I run out I’m going to easily fork over the $15 for it at Ulta. The setting spray I’ve been loving this past month is the Kat Von D Lock It setting mist. I know there has been a lot of controversy around Kat Von D and I may not support her views on things but that doesn’t mean I can’t enjoy her product. I got this at IMATS this year because I’ve been wanting to try it and I really like it. It’s a contender with my Urban Decay All Nighter Setting Spray which is my ride or die. This really, well, locks in my makeup and makes it last all day and night.

Now onto lips. Oddly enough, I purchased all three of these things at IMATS this year and now I’m in love. Let’s start with the Dose of Colors Matte Liquid Lipstick in ‘Stone’. I am so glad there was a rep showing these lip products who helped me choose this color because on first look it’s not something I would have even looked at. Yet when I said pinky-nude, she pointed me right towards ‘Stone’ and I haven’t been able to stop wearing it! It is actually quite comfortable on the lips for a matte liquid lipstick and the pigmentation is really nice too. It lasts as long as I don’t eat something oily or greasy (which is the same for any liquid lipstick really). I bought my first Lime Crime products at the show this year, I got their Plushies Liquid Lipstick in ‘Rosebud’ and their Velvetines Lip Liner in ‘Pinky Swear’. I don’t think I will ever buy from their site after what happened but in person or at Ulta I will do. I now want to get more Plushies and Velvetine Lip Liners because I. LOVE. THEM! This combination has been my go-to since I tried it at the show. It’s the perfect combination because the Plushie is a sheerer formula of liquid lipstick so the lip liner shows through a bit. I think if I had to pick one lip liner and lip product combo to wear for the next year it would 99.99% be this! In. Love.

One of the two eyeshadow palettes I’ve loved this month is the Morphe 39L ‘Hit the Lights’ palette. I know Morphe is one of those brands where you either love them (me) or hate them. I love how this palette is broken up into eyeshadow combos of eight with seven basic shades in the center. I haven’t had a chance to try all the looks I want to with this palette but trust me, when I do, they will go up here and on my Instagram (@ emmadelfosse_mua). I love how each area is so different from the one next to it, I especially love the lower right-hand corner. All matte, which isn’t my thing, but bright colors, which is my thing. I really do love all of the Morphe palettes I own but the two ‘artistry’ palettes are in my top 3 with the Jaclyn Hill palette taking number one.

My last favorite palette from this month, and subsequently my last product, is the Huda Beauty Nude Obsessions eyeshadow palette in ‘Light’. Again, I picked this up at IMATS (take a shot every time I say IMATS- I could start a drinking game!) and I have LOVED using it. The mattes are creamy and easy to blend and the shimmers really pack a punch, especially when applied with your finger. This could be looked at as similar to her New Nudes palette, which I own and love, and I can see that but only in the shimmers. I could take this with me on vacation and have a different look every single day just from this little nine pan palette. If you’ve been considering purchasing either the light, medium, or rich I say do it. You won’t regret it.
